    New Educational Pathways to Middle-Class Jobs

    Jeffrey Selingo, Joseph Aoun, Gene Block, John Hickenlooper, Gail Mellow, Gregg Roden, Jeff Selingo, Patrick Fine, Nick Hilsner, Mark Yossowitz, Ray Jacobson, Jason Summers

    Panelists from government, industry, and academia address the widening gap between traditional education and modern workforce demands by showcasing employer-led apprenticeships and micro-credentialing programs at Frito-Lay, LaGuardia Community College, and Colorado. Experts advocate for integrating "robot-proof" soft skills and coding literacy into core curricula while shifting toward lifelong learning models that combine technical training with human-centric adaptability. The discussion concludes that without systemic reforms including state-sponsored national service and expanded private-sector training, automation will increasingly displace workers, exacerbating wage stagnation and unemployment.

    Asia's Imperative: Educating the Fastest-Growing Middle Class in History

    Kirk Wagar, Gene Block, Brian Rogove, Thomas Rosenbaum, Lee Tran

    A panel of academic and industry leaders discusses the strategic necessity of expanding U.S. higher education access to Asia's growing middle class, which is projected to reach 3.2 billion people by 2030. Speakers from UCLA and Caltech highlight how international students serve as critical revenue sources for public institutions while addressing systemic barriers such as English proficiency gaps and restrictive visa policies. The dialogue concludes by emphasizing educational exchange as a vital soft power tool for maintaining global diplomatic ties and driving innovation amidst rising political scrutiny.
